Output 3aa741a81d2160379075ca38508aea7149e887d00d9448235b869be4fd3589df:3

value
170552902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b3beeec1c091d86c7fa323d982119143ba2a23 OP_EQUAL
address
3H52mjKjXnw4THtB5A3uPEFy6f4ewt2toY
transaction
3aa741a81d2160379075ca38508aea7149e887d00d9448235b869be4fd3589df
spent
true